Floor thickness measurement control gadget
Technical Field
The utility model relates to a building technical field especially relates to a floor thickness measurement control gadget.
Background
At present, the control of the thickness of the floor in the building engineering is always a key point and a difficult point of quality control, so that the quality accidents caused by the control are endless. The existing method for measuring the thickness of the floor slab is generally directly inserted into concrete through a measuring scale, although the method is simple, the concrete structure can be damaged, and the surface of the measuring scale can be polluted by the direct contact of the concrete and the measuring scale, so that the reading is inconvenient.

Drawings
Fig. 1 is a schematic structural view of a floor thickness measurement control gadget provided by the present invention;
fig. 2 is an external structural schematic view of a floor thickness measurement control gadget provided by the present invention;
fig. 3 is a schematic structural view of a fixing mechanism of a floor thickness measurement control gadget provided by the present invention;
fig. 4 is a schematic structural view of a scraping mechanism of a floor thickness measurement control gadget provided by the present invention;
fig. 5 is the utility model provides a structural schematic of the doctor-bar of floor thickness measurement control gadget.
In the figure: the scraping device comprises an outer barrel body 1, a bottom plate 2, an insertion rod 3, a fixing rod 4, a limiting groove 5, a fixing ring 6, a top plate 7, an inner barrel body 8, a first spring 9, a limiting block 10, a second spring 11, a placing groove 12, a supporting block 13, a scraping blade 14, a mounting groove 15, a supporting rod 16, a tension spring 17 and a scraping groove 18.

Wherein, fixed establishment includes the stopper 10 of sliding connection in standing groove 12, fixedly connected with second spring 11 on the stopper 10, and the other end fixed connection of second spring 11 is on the inner wall of standing groove 12, and stopper 10 end is the inclined plane structure, and the inclined plane is down.
Wherein, the scraping groove 18 is of a semicircular structure and is attached to the outer wall of the inserted bar 3, so that the scraping effect is good.
Furthermore, the upper end of the inserted bar 3 is fixedly connected with a fixing ring 6, so that the inner cylinder 8 of the movable bar is pressed downwards when the movable bar is used.
When the utility model is used, the bottom plate 2 is pressed on the upper surface of the concrete body, the inner cylinder body 8 slides downwards until the lower end of the inserted bar 3 is pressed against the template, and the limiting block 10 is pressed into the limiting groove 5 under the elastic action of the second spring 11, the inner cylinder body 8 is further limited and fixed, the device is taken out, the thickness of the floor concrete can be read by referring to the scale marks on the side wall of the inner cylinder body 8, after the device is taken out after measurement, the abutting blocks 13 on the two sides are manually abutted, namely, the two scraping blades 14 are driven by the abutting rod 16 to abut against the inserted rod 3, the inner cylinder 8 is rotated to enable the limiting block 10 to rotate out of the limiting groove 5, the inner cylinder 8 moves upwards and resets under the elastic force of the first spring 9 to drive the inserted rod 3 to move upwards, the surface of the inserted rod 3 can be scraped by the scraping blade 14, and the excessive concrete on the surface of the inserted rod 3 can be taken out to keep the inserted rod 3 clean.
